Summary
The nature of olfaction; its importance for understanding perennial issues of philosophy of mind, perception, and consciousness; and its implications for cognitive neuroscience.
What are smells? Despite the best efforts of philosophy and the chemosciences, the question remains vexing—but no more perplexing than the historical lapse of the past centuries to seriously consider a sense that has a key place in philosophy of mind and perception. About The Author
Benjamin Young
Benjamin Young is Associate Professor in Philosophy and a member of the graduate faculty in interdisciplinary neuroscience and the Institute for Neuroscience at the University of Nevada, Reno. He is the coeditor of Mind, Cognition, and Neuroscience and of the collection Theoretical Perspectives on Smell.
